The history of artificial refrigeration began when
William Cullen designed a small refrigerating
machine in 1755. Cullen used a pump to create a
partial vacuum over a container of diethyl ether,
which then boiled, absorbing heat from the
surrounding air. The experiment even created a
small amount of ice, but had no practical application
at that time.

Daniel Gabriel Fahrenheit (24 Medical

May 1686 - 16 September 1736) was a Inventions
physicist, inventor and scientific instrument

maker. A pioneer of exact thermometry, he helped lay the foundations for the

era of precision thermometry by inventing the mercury-

in-glass thermometer (first practical, accurate

thermometer) and Fahrenheit scale (first standardized

temperature scale to be widely used). He determined his

scale by reference to three fixed points of temperature.

The lowest temperature was achieved by preparing a

frigorific mixture of ice, water and salt and waiting for the

eutectic system to reach equilibrium temperature. The

thermometer then was placed into the mixture and the liquid in the

thermometer allowed to descend to its lowest point. The thermometer's

reading there was taken as 0 °F. The second reference point was selected as

the reading of the thermometer when it was placed in still water when ice was

just forming on the surface. This was assigned as 30 °F. The third calibration

point, taken as 90 °F, was selected as the thermometer's reading when the

instrument was placed under the arm or in the mouth.

Fahrenheit came up with the idea that Mercury boils around 300 degrees on
this temperature scale. The Fahrenheit scale was the primary temperature
standard for climatic, industrial and medical purposes.

Food & Coenraad Johannes van

Processes Houten (15 March 1801 – 27 May

1887) was a Dutch chemist and chocolate maker known for the treatment of

cocoa mass with alkaline salts to remove the bitter taste and make cocoa

solids solid more water-soluble; the resulting product is still

called "Dutch process chocolate". He is also credited

with introducing a method for pressing the fat (cocoa

butter) from roasted cocoa beans, though this was in

fact his father, Casparus van Houten's invention. The

introduction of cocoa powder not only made creating

chocolate drinks much easier, but also made it possible

to combine the powder with sugar and then remix it with

cocoa butter to create a solid, already closely resembles

today's eating chocolate. Coenraad Van Houten introduced a further

improvement by treating the powder with alkaline salts (potassium or sodium

carbonates) so that the powder would mix more easily with water. Today, this

process is known as "Dutching". The final product, Dutch chocolate, has a

dark color and a mild taste.

In 1838 the patent expired, enabling others to produce cocoa powder and
build on Van Houten's success, experimenting to make new chocolate
products. In 1847 English chocolate maker J. S. Fry & Sons produced
arguably the first chocolate bar. Later developments were in Switzerland,
where Daniel Peter introduced milk chocolate in 1875 and Rodolphe Lindt
made chocolate more blendable by the process of conching in 1879.

James Gregory (November 1638 – October

1675) was a Scottish mathematician and astronomer. He
described an early practical design for the reflecting
telescope – the Gregorian telescope – and made
advances in trigonometry, discovering infinite series
representations for several trigonometric functions.
In his 1663 Optica Promota, James Gregory described his reflecting telescope
which has come to be known by his name, the Gregorian telescope. Gregory
pointed out that a reflecting telescope with a parabolic mirror would correct
spherical aberration as well as the chromatic aberration seen in refracting
telescopes.

Karl Guthe Jansky (22 October 1905 – 14

February 1950) was an American physicist and radio
engineer who in August 1931 first discovered radio waves
emanating from the Milky Way. He is considered one of the
founding figures of radio astronomy. After recording
signals from all directions for several months, the brightest
point moved away from the position of the Sun. He also
determined that the signal repeated on a cycle of 23 hours
and 56 minutes, the period of the Earth's rotation relative to the stars, instead
of relative to the sun. By comparing his observations with optical astronomical
maps, he concluded that the radiation was coming from the Milky Way and
was strongest in the direction of the center of the galaxy.

Narcís Monturiol i Estarriol (28

September 1819 – 6 September 1885) was a Spanish
artist and engineer. He was the inventor of the first air-
independent and combustion-engine-driven submarine.
In 1858 Monturiol presented his project in a scientific
thesis, titled The Ictineo or fish-ship. The first dive of his
first submarine, Ictineo I, took place in September 1859
in the harbour of Barcelona. Ictineo I was 7 m long with a
beam of 2.5 m and draft of 3.5 m. Her intended use was
to ease the harvest of coral. An improved version of Ictineo I, Ictineo II was
launched on 2 October 1864. Ictineo II made her maiden voyage under
human power on 20 May 1865, submerging to a depth of 30 m. On 22
October 1867, Ictineo II made her first surface journey under steam power,
averaging 3.5 kn (6.5 km/h) with a top speed of 4.5 kn (8.3 km/h).

Kitti's hog-nosed bat is about 29 to 33 mm (1.1 to 1.3 in) in length and 2 g
(0.071 oz) in mass, hence the common name of "bumblebee bat". It is the
smallest species of bat and may be the world's smallest mammal, depending
on how size is defined. The main competitors for the title are small shrews; in
particular, the Etruscan shrew may be lighter at 1.2 to 2.7 g (0.042 to 0.095 oz)
but is longer, measuring 36 to 53 mm (1.4 to 2.1 in) from its head to the base
of the tail.

The frog lives on land and its life cycle
does not include a tadpole stage. instead, members of this species hatch as
'hoppers': miniatures of the adults. The skeleton is reduced and there are only
seven presacral vertebrae present. They are capable of jumping thirty times
their body length. The frog is crepuscular and feeds on small invertebrates.
Males call for mates with a series of very high-pitched insect-like peeps at a
frequency of 8400–9400 Hz.

What is the difference between an Emu and an Ostrich?
Emus are the second largest birds native to Australia while Ostrich is largest bird native to Africa. Emus have deep brown
feathers with it being very difficult to distinguish the males and females except during mating season while the ostrich males
have black and white and females have brown feathers.
Emus and ostriches are polygamous in different ways. Female emus mate with a male, lay eggs, and then leave that male,
who incubates and cares for offspring. The female then mates with another male. Male ostriches fight to create a harem of
five to seven females.
Emus have three toes on each foot in a tridactyl arrangement, which is an adaptation for running and is seen in other birds,
such as bustards and quails. The ostrich has two toes on each foot.
